EMH and Typhoon Lagoon, Animal Kingdom..
I was looking at the late July/early August park hours and noticed that Animal Kingdom and Typhoon Lagoon have extra magic hours from 8-11pm.
Does TL get the full 3 hours EMH? Is it easy and fun in the dark? Crowds? AK has a small list of attractions open. Would the crowds here be heavy? Ive never been here in the dark, Its probably interesting. Might be a night to tour opposite the EMH. Has anyone not seen the full 3 hour EMH evening window? |

Re: EMH and Typhoon Lagoon, Animal Kingdom..
Im actually thinking that it might be good to tour away from the EMH here. Last time I wen't in Summer MK was open until 11. We had an empty park from 9-11. On the EMH night (10-1am), we were jammed.
Im guessing the waterpark should not be crowded after 8pm. |

Re: EMH and Typhoon Lagoon, Animal Kingdom..
We did evening EMH's at AK in august and loved it. AK is such an interesting park at night. Even if many attractions are not open it is just nice to walk around and enjoy the park at night, It gave us a new feeling about AK. I loved it after dark!!
We did not do EMH's at TL though. It sounds like it might be a good time. We might be going back again this august we might have to check it out.
